To find the vertex, you can use the formula x = -b/2a, where a and b are coefficients of the quadratic equation. The y-coordinate of the vertex can be found by substituting the x-value back into the equation.

A parabola is a mathematical curve that is shaped like a U. The vertex is the point at the center of the U, where the curve changes direction. Imagine a ball rolling on a flat surface; as it approaches the vertex, its speed and direction change. The vertex plays a crucial role in determining the behavior of the parabola, including its opening direction, axis of symmetry, and position of the maximum or minimum value.
